Obituary for Susan S Kindig Susan Friend Kindig (nee Sheppard) died peacefully on December 15, 2018 at Ohio Living Westminster-Thurber in Columbus, Ohio at the age of 100. Susan was born on May 3, 1918 in Washington Courthouse, Ohio to Jonathan Ernest Sheppard and Nelle Bess (Cochran) Sheppard. She graduated from Ohio State University with a Bachelors Degree in Education and Masters Degree in Reading.
Susan married Harold Friend in 1938 and raised their two children on a farm outside Sedalia, Ohio. Susan worked for Midway Elementary as a 5th Grade Teacher. She was a generous individual who was passionate about educating students.
Susan later served as Gifted/Special Education Supervisor for Madison County until she was 70 years old. After Harold passed away in 1973, she later met Fred Kindig on a blind date arranged by a colleague whom happened to be Fred’s daughter. They married in 1980, lived in Worthington, Ohio and travelled the world extensively.
Susan remembers her mother, Nelle, as a mother that was always there for her. And, Susan’s children feel the very same about their mother. Lee and Judy remember her as a grateful mother that loved the educational field and made family her priority.
No wonder Thanksgiving was her favorite holiday! Susan loved to read, especially mystery novels. She enjoyed Big Band music and doing the Fox Trot, Waltz and Square & Round Dance.
Susan’s fondest memories of both husbands was on the dance floor! Susan is preceded in death by her first husband, Harold L. Friend and second husband, Frederick E. Kindig.
